What are the best areas to buy a condominium in the Dominican Republic?
The ideal location for your Dominican Republic condominium depends largely on your priorities. Some of the most popular areas include:
-
Punta Cana: Known for its world-class resorts, stunning beaches, and vibrant nightlife, Punta Cana offers a wide array of luxury condominium options. Expect higher prices here, reflecting the area's popularity.
-
Cabarete: This area is a mecca for watersports enthusiasts, boasting consistent winds ideal for kitesurfing and windsurfing. Condominiums here tend to cater to a more active lifestyle.
-
Puerto Plata: A historically rich city with a charming colonial zone, Puerto Plata offers a blend of cultural experiences and beautiful beaches. You'll find a wider range of price points here compared to Punta Cana.
-
Las Terrenas: This quieter, more bohemian area on the SamanĂ¡ Peninsula is known for its laid-back atmosphere and stunning beaches. It's a great option for those seeking a more tranquil escape.
What is the average price of a condominium in the Dominican Republic?
The price of a condominium in the Dominican Republic varies significantly depending on location, size, amenities, and condition. Luxury condos in prime locations like Punta Cana can range from several hundred thousand to millions of dollars. More affordable options can be found in areas like Puerto Plata or smaller towns, potentially starting in the lower hundreds of thousands. It's crucial to conduct thorough research and work with a reputable real estate agent to find a property that fits your budget.
What are the costs associated with buying a condominium in the Dominican Republic?
Beyond the purchase price, several other costs are associated with buying a condominium in the Dominican Republic. These include:
-
Closing costs: These can vary but typically include legal fees, registration fees, and transfer taxes.
-
Property taxes: These are relatively low compared to many other countries.
-
HOA fees: Most condominiums have homeowner's association fees that cover maintenance, security, and other common area expenses.
-
Insurance: It's essential to secure appropriate insurance coverage for your property.
